Transforming Sight into Speech: The Evolution of Image-to-Text Technology
From its humble beginnings in rudimentary optical character recognition applications to the sophisticated deep learning algorithms fueling today's state-of-the-art systems, the journey of image-to-text technology has been marked by remarkable progress. Early attempts primarily focused on identifying simple text from printed materials, often with limited accuracy and scope.
- Nonetheless, the emergence of convolutional neural networks (CNNs) revolutionized the field, enabling the understanding of more complex visual content.
- This breakthrough paved the way for a new range of applications, including automated document processing, image captioning, and textual search.
Today, image-to-text technology has become an integral part of our digital world, powering a wide array of tools that improve our daily lives.
